齿轮类型及其几何学与啮合理论的分析与实现——基于李特文《齿轮几何学与啮合理论》的MATLAB程序探究,《齿轮几何学与啮合理论及其MATLAB程序实现》

news/2024/11/5 21:44:25 标签: 几何学, matlab, 算法

齿轮、行星齿轮、端面齿轮、斜齿轮、非圆齿轮、圆弧齿轮……啮合理论、啮合原理、齿面求解、传动特性、接触分析tca、传动误差等技术matlab程序实现。
参照李特文《齿轮几何学与啮合理论》

ID:21450706743787164

用户_06541178


齿轮是机械传动中常用的零部件,广泛应用于各个行业的机械设备中。在齿轮传动中,有许多不同类型的齿轮,例如行星齿轮、端面齿轮、斜齿轮、非圆齿轮、圆弧齿轮等,每种齿轮都有其独特的设计和应用。本文将围绕齿轮的啮合理论展开讨论,探讨齿轮传动中的关键问题。

啮合理论是研究齿轮传动中齿轮啮合运动的理论基础,它涵盖了齿轮传动的许多重要概念和原理。在啮合理论中,齿面求解是一个关键的问题。齿面求解是指根据齿轮的几何参数和啮合条件,确定齿轮的实际齿面形状。通过齿面求解,可以保证齿轮的正常啮合,并提高传动效率和传动精度。

在齿轮传动中,传动特性是评价其性能的重要指标之一。传动特性涵盖了许多方面的内容,例如传动比、传动效率、传动误差等。其中,传动误差是一个重要的研究领域。传动误差是指实际齿轮啮合运动与理论运动之间的差异,它直接关系到齿轮传动的精度和稳定性。通过对传动误差的研究,可以提高齿轮传动的性能,并减小传动误差对机械设备的影响。

为了更好地研究齿轮传动中的问题,许多学者和工程师都开发了各种各样的工具和方法。其中,Matlab程序是一种常用的工具,它可以实现齿轮传动中的啮合分析和传动特性计算。通过Matlab程序,可以快速准确地得到齿轮传动的相关参数,并进行深入的分析和优化。

在研究齿轮传动中的问题时,可以参考李特文的著作《齿轮几何学与啮合理论》。这本书详细介绍了齿轮的几何学原理和啮合理论,对于理解齿轮传动的基本原理和解决实际问题具有重要的参考价值。

综上所述,齿轮传动是机械传动中常用的一种形式,通过对齿轮的啮合理论的研究,可以实现齿轮传动的优化设计和性能提升。在研究齿轮传动中的问题时,可以借助Matlab程序进行分析和计算,同时参考李特文的著作,深入了解齿轮的几何学原理和啮合理论。通过这些努力,我们可以不断提高齿轮传动的精度和稳定性,为机械设备的运行提供可靠的保障。

【相关代码,程序地址】:http://fansik.cn/706743787164.html


http://www.niftyadmin.cn/n/5739879.html

相关文章

字符类型模糊查询优化案例一

在实际开中中经常会遇到 like %a 运算,一般在数据库中此种写法不能使用索引优化查询,本示例提供一个简单的优化思路 这里借鉴 oracle 的反向索引的设计理念 可以在该表结构的基础上增加一个新的字段,该字段为目标字段的 REVERSE 使用触发…

成都睿明智科技有限公司共赴抖音电商蓝海

在这个短视频风起云涌的时代,抖音作为现象级的社交媒体平台,不仅改变了人们的娱乐方式,更悄然间重塑了电商行业的格局。在这片充满机遇与挑战的蓝海中,成都睿明智科技有限公司凭借其敏锐的市场洞察力和专业的服务能力,…

算法专题:栈

目录 1. 删除字符串中的所有相邻重复项 1.1 算法原理 1.2 算法代码 2. 844. 比较含退格的字符串 2.1 算法原理 2.2 算法原理 3. 基本计算器 II 3.1 算法原理 3.2 算法代码 4. 字符串解码 4.1 算法原理 4.2 算法代码 5. 验证栈序列 5.1 算法原理 5.2 算法代码 1.…

bert-base-chinese模型使用教程

向量编码和向量相似度展示 import torch from transformers import BertTokenizer, BertModel import numpy as npmodel_name "C:/Users/Administrator.DESKTOP-TPJL4TC/.cache/modelscope/hub/tiansz/bert-base-chinese"sentences [春眠不觉晓, 大梦谁先觉, 浓睡…

华为HarmonyOS借助AR引擎帮助应用实现虚拟与现实交互的能力4-检测环境中的平面

本章节介绍如何通过AR Engine进行平面检测。通过学习本章节,您可以检测当前环境中的平面,并在您的应用中处理这些平面。 创建ARSession 您可以参考管理AR会话创建ARSession。 创建平面对象列表 创建一个平面对象列表planeList,用于存放AR…

【WebApi】C# webapi 后端接收部分属性

在C#的Web API后端接收部分属性,可以使用[FromBody]特性配合JsonPatchDocument或者Delta来实现。这里提供一个使用JsonPatchDocument的示例。 首先,定义一个模型类:public class User public class User {public int Id {get; set; }

Rust移动开发:Rust在Android端集成使用介绍

Andorid调用Rust 目前Rust在移动端上的应用,一般作为应用sdk的提供,供各端使用,目前飞书底层使用Rust编写通用组件。 该篇适合对Android、Rust了解,想看如何做整合,如果想要工程源码,可以评论或留言有解疑…

人生后半场更看重质量

年轻刚开始工作的时候,属于学习期,各个方面都要了解一下,尝试一下。这个过程,一方面向外观察行业、前景,学习具体的知识,另外一方面,也要开始向内观察,了解自己的喜好、优点、志向。…